package org.apache.flink.api.common.accumulators;
import org.apache.flink.annotation.PublicEvolving;
/**
* An accumulator that sums up {@code double} values.
*/
@PublicEvolving
public class DoubleCounter implements SimpleAccumulator<Double> {
private static final long serialVersionUID = 1L;
private double localValue = 0;
public DoubleCounter() {}
public DoubleCounter(double value) {
this.localValue = value;
}
// ------------------------------------------------------------------------
// Accumulator
// ------------------------------------------------------------------------
/**
* Consider using {@link #add(double)} instead for primitive double values
*/
@Override
public void add(Double value) {
localValue += value;
}
@Override
public Double getLocalValue() {
return localValue;
}
@Override
public void merge(Accumulator<Double, Double> other) {
this.localValue += other.getLocalValue();
}
@Override
public void resetLocal() {
this.localValue = 0;
}
@Override
public DoubleCounter clone() {
DoubleCounter result = new DoubleCounter();
result.localValue = localValue;
return result;
}
// ------------------------------------------------------------------------
// Primitive Specializations
// ------------------------------------------------------------------------
public void add(double value){
localValue += value;
}
public double getLocalValuePrimitive() {
return this.localValue;
}
// ------------------------------------------------------------------------
// Utilities
// ------------------------------------------------------------------------
@Override
public String toString() {
return "DoubleCounter " + this.localValue;
}
}
